### Step 4: Update pagination handling

The Wrenfield public API v3 replaces page numbers with opaque cursors. Support agents verifying customer reports should pass the `next_cursor` value from each response rather than incrementing a page parameter. Old page-based calls return 410 after the cutover. To cross-check cursor state during escalations, query the pagination audit table using the connection string below.

replica DSN, kajep-yahag: mssql://praok_svc:iF@db-8d68.plorvaio.local:5432/eliion

# Lanternleaf UI Environments

Snapshot tests for Lanternleaf UI components run against the preview environment only. Golden images are regenerated nightly; mismatches page on-call if the failure rate exceeds five percent. Staging shares the preview renderer but uses production fonts, so diffs there are advisory. If snapshots flake, check renderer versions first. The preview environment runs with the following configuration values.

service settings:
PRAIX_LOG_LEVEL=error
PRAIX_METRICS_HOST=metrics.praix.qorvelcorp.corp
PRAIX_POOL_SIZE=16

The turnstile counter service tallies entries at every gate of Bramblehollow Stadium and streams totals to the capacity dashboard used by event safety staff. Each turnstile sends a heartbeat every five seconds; if three consecutive heartbeats are missed, the gate is marked stale and its counts are frozen until reconciliation. Never restart the aggregator during an active event without sign-off from the safety lead, as counts may briefly double. The complete architecture overview and reconciliation procedure are documented on the page below.

runbook for badug-kadup: https://confluence.zemvarlabs.internal/projects/browse/display/projects/bd1b